This course of 10 web seminars offers detailed information and guidance on all aspects of development and education for young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5 years).


This structured course offers 10 seminars to cover all aspects of development and education for young children with Down syndrome from birth to 5 years. Each session lasts 1.5 hours, including 50-60 minutes for the live presentation and 30-40 minutes for the interactive discussion.

This course of web seminars is suitable for teachers, teaching assistants, educational/school psychologists, speech and language therapists/pathologists, other health and education professionals, representatives of support groups and families seeking detailed information. It is available to participants worldwide. 

Web seminars are provided online with a choice of Internet or telephone audio services. For telephone audio, we offer toll-free access in 48 countries*. Participants receive downloadable presentation handouts and resource lists.


Course content

This course includes the following 10 seminars - click on the links to read the description for each session:

  1. What does research tell us about the specific learning needs of young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5 years)?
  2. Language and communication skills for young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5)
  3. Speech and verbal memory skills for young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5 years)
  4. What does research tell us about teaching young children with Down syndrome to read (birth to 5 years)?
  5. Early reading skills for young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5 years)
  6. Evidence for the benefits of inclusion in education for young children with Down syndrome and the keys to success (birth to 5 years)
  7. Play, number and cognitive skills for young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5 years)
  8. Motor skills and self-help for young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5 years)
  9. Social development and behaviour for young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5 years)
  10. Looking forward: How do we support full inclusion and meaningful lives for young children with Down syndrome (birth to 5 years)?
